Maximize Profits and Productivity with Custom Shopify Apps Designed to Scale



Overview


In the current competitive e-commerce landscape, Shopify sellers are always searching for methods to boost revenue and streamline their operations. A highly effective solution is through tailored Shopify apps tailored to address individual business needs. Integrating with the Shopify API and leveraging resources like the Polaris design system, such applications enable organizations to scale efficiently while enhancing customer engagement. In this blog, we’ll discuss key aspects of Shopify application creation, from design considerations and essential features to effective methods for upkeeping and scaling apps effectively.

1. Grasping Shopify API Linkage


A solid understanding of Shopify’s API—involving Representational State Transfer and Graph Query Language—is essential for creating reliable Shopify apps. With these APIs, programmers can fetch, change, and handle data within a Shopify site. The Graph Query Language interface provides optimized data handling, allowing for faster replies by obtaining only the necessary data. Linking to the API enables developers to adapt app functionality to the organization's specific requirements, ensuring a smooth UX that enhances store efficiency and revenue.

2. Utilizing the Shopify’s Polaris framework


Shopify’s design system enables developers to create a consistent and user-friendly interaction across Shopify applications. Polaris provides a range of components and best practices that align with Shopify’s branding, ensuring apps look native within the Shopify environment. This strategy doesn’t just supports intuitive app navigation but also aids ensure branding uniformity, an critical component in creating credibility with clients.

3. Creating within the Shopify Application Network


The Shopify app ecosystem is vast, permitting developers to create embedded Shopify applications that function in a shop's control interface. Internal apps optimize the user experience by integrating seamlessly within Shopify’s interface, cutting down on the requirement for distinct sign-ins or further browsing. For creators, using Node.js for backend tasks and React.js for the front end has become a popular choice, as such tools enable growth-ready, responsive apps that deliver an high-quality UX.

4. Key Features for Shopify Applications


A high-performing Shopify application requires features that tackle key challenges in the digital sales process. Real-time alerts for real-time notifications, custom theme customization options, and cross-channel commerce features are essential additions that can boost business oversight and user interactions. By integrating these features, Shopify applications don’t just simplify in-house tasks but also enhance the overall customer experience.

5. Key Strategies for App Development


When building Shopify apps, it’s important to adhere to standard guidelines. App maintenance strategies such as regular Shopify customization options updates, customer support, and protection protocols are vital for building customer loyalty. Online visibility strategies for Shopify apps can also be utilized to enhance app reach and adoption. User retention strategies, like app alerts and loyalty programs, are key for keeping customers and fostering a devoted customer base.

6. Growing Shopify Apps for Growth


As Shopify businesses expand, growing app performance becomes vital to manage higher user loads and functionality demands. Leveraging serverless architecture and focusing on efficient data handling through GraphQL can help applications grow without performance issues. It’s also necessary to have a plan for expanding the app’s backend systems to manage increased demand, which includes a guide for selecting a development partner with expertise in Shopify applications.

7. Evaluating the Cost of Creating Shopify Apps


Building personalized Shopify apps can differ widely in cost depending on the features, connections, and personalization necessary. Fundamental elements like data connections, user interaction elements, and promotional features can increase expenses. However, the return on investment (ROI) is often beneficial, as these apps can significantly boost profits and streamline store operations.

8. Support Plans


Keeping apps updated is equally necessary as initially building it. Regular updates to address issues, improve security, and maintain integration with the new Shopify versions are essential. Forward-thinking upkeep methods also include client help and function upgrades that keep up with changing online shopping trends.

9. Platforms for Developing Shopify Apps


Shopify supplies various tools to ease the creation workflow, from app development frameworks like Node.js and React to automated notifications for instant alerts. Tools like Shopify’s CLI streamline the app creation path, while Shopify App Bridge allows internal apps to connect easily with Shopify’s control panel. Such tools are key for building applications that are both effective and intuitive.

10. Upcoming Innovations in Shopify App Creation


The prospects of Shopify app development is bright, with innovations moving towards artificial intelligence capabilities, expanded multi-platform integration, and new application add-ons. As online shopping progresses, app creators will have to keep up with new directions to create applications that go beyond satisfy but surpass customer needs.

Conclusion


Tailored applications for Shopify give a effective way for online stores to grow effectively, increase revenue, and enhance workflows. From connecting with data interfaces and the design standards to advanced features and maintenance strategies, all factors of Shopify app development plays a important role in ensuring a user-friendly experience for shoppers. As Shopify moves forward, keeping up with emerging directions in app development will enable developers fully utilize Shopify’s comprehensive offerings, reinforcing future of Shopify app building their standing in the e-commerce market.


Leave a Reply

Your email address will not be published. Required fields are marked *